免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 832 | 回复: 0
打印 上一主题 下一主题

Struts环境配置手记(转) [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2006-08-18 16:24 |只看该作者 |倒序浏览
Struts环境配置手记
  1.Eclipse
  下载网址: http://www.eclipse.org/
  
  2.tomcat
  下载网址: http://jakarta.apache.org/site/binindex.cgi
  
  3.struts
  下载网址: http://jakarta.apache.org/site/binindex.cgi
  
  4.tomcat for Eclipse插件
  下载网址: http://www.sysdeo.com/eclipse/tomcatPlugin.html
  
  5.easy struts插件
  下载网址: http://sourceforge.net/projects/easystruts
  
  6.EJB开发工具lomboz(不是必需的)
  下载网址: http://www.objectlearn.com/
  
  把上述4中的com.sysdeo.eclipse.tomcat_2.2.1和上述5中的com.cross.easystruts.eclipse_0.6.4分别COPY到
  eclipse\plugins\,然后进行以下设置
  
  1.Tomcat的初始化设置:启动Eclipse,通过菜单Windows->Preferences打开设置窗口
  选择Tomcat并做配置
  2.Easy Struts的初始化设置:启动Eclipse,通过菜单Windows->Preferences打开设置窗口
  选择struts 1.1并在struts 1.1所需的库文件中找到并添加struts.jar文件
  3.在struts 1.1所需的类型库描述文件中建议至少加入前面提到的三个描述文件分别是:
  struts_html.tld、struts_bean.tld、struts_logic.tld,这三个文件会在创建struts应用项目时自动拷贝到项目的WEB-INF目录下。
  4.新建一个Tomcat项目,然后右击project->Properties->Libraries,把struts 1.1中的包全部加入\r
  5.新建Add Easy Struts Support
  6.把struts 1.1中的包全部COPY到project->WEB-INF\LIB
  用JAVA连接SQL Server 2000取得数据
  1.下载JDBC FOR SQLSERVER 的驱动:
  http://www.microsoft.com/downloads/details.aspx?FamilyID=4f8f2f01-1ed7-4c4d-8f7b-3d47969e66ae&DisplayLang=en#filelist
  点击setup.exe下载驱动
  2.下载后开始安装,就用默认设置安装,会被安装到:
  C:\Program Files\Microsoft SQL Server 2000 Driver for JDBC
  3.把C:\Program Files\Microsoft SQL Server 2000 Driver for JDBC\lib
  下面的mssqlserver.jar,msbase.jar,msutil.jar三个文件拷贝到你的
  JDK主目录\jre\lib\ext下面,现在JDBC驱动就算配置好了
  4.编译运行测试程序:
  String driverName = "com.microsoft.jdbc.sqlserver.SQLServerDriver";
  String connURL = "jdbc:microsoft:sqlserver://BLUESKY:1433;User=sa;Password=sa;DatabaseName=sitedb";
  try{
  Class.forName(driverName);
  Connection conn = DriverManager.getConnection(connURL);
  Statement stmt = conn.createStatement();
  StringBuffer strsql = new StringBuffer();
  strsql.append("select * from USERTABLE where username ='" + username + "'");
  ResultSet rs = stmt.executeQuery(strsql.toString());
  if(!rs.next() ||!password.equals(NulltoString(rs.getString("password")).trim())){
  DBmsg = "对不起,您所输入的用户不存在或用户密码不正确";
  }else{
  username = NulltoString(rs.getString("username"));
  selectright = NulltoString(rs.getString("selectright"));
  deleteright = NulltoString(rs.getString("deleteright"));
  updateright = NulltoString(rs.getString("updateright"));
  }
  
  }catch (ClassNotFoundException ex){
  ex.printStackTrace();
  }catch (SQLException ex){
  ex.printStackTrace();
  }

本文来自ChinaUnix博客,如果查看原文请点:http://blog.chinaunix.net/u/14366/showart_157244.html
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P